Why We Should Be Encouraging Our Children To Walk Or Cycle To School

With hundreds of thousands of children returning to school over the next couple of weeks, there is still uncertainty among many parents about how they will get there, particularly given the situation with social distancing on school buses. Only 2% of Irish children cycle to school at present, but should we be encouraging more of them to do so? Psychotherapist Stella O'Malley joined us on The Last Word to talk about why walking or cycling to school is important for children's confidence and independence.
